From the Rolls-Royce experimental archive: a quarter of a million communications from Rolls-Royce, 1906 to 1960's. Documents from the Sir Henry Royce Memorial Foundation (SHRMF).
Letter to A.T. Colwell of Thompson Products, Inc., regarding copper-cooled and sodium-cooled valves.

Dear Colwell,

Thanks very much for your letter of December 12th, together with the information it contained.

I think, under the circumstances, we will not bother with copper-cooled valves for the time being.

I shall be interested to know whether there is any sodium-cooled valve in production in either commercial or passenger car units in the States.
